Brenmoor Optics alleges that the Faelight rendering suite infringes terms of the co-development agreement signed three years ago. Their position: commercial resale outside the Keverton region was never authorised. Our position: the amendment signed later that year extended the territory.

Current status: mediation scheduled for next quarter; Faelight sales continue under legal advice, with revenue ring-fenced. No public statements without comms approval. For the incoming director, the strategic backdrop is set out below.

internal memo for kaduf-baduf: Only 35 of the 378 pilot accounts renewed Holir, so a churn review is set for June 11. Eliielax Group is in early talks to buy Silaelix Group for about $142.1 million.

TICKET-4471: Signature check failing on sqllint-rules bundle

The sqlward pipeline rejects the linting-rules artifact since Tuesday. Cause: bundle was re-signed after the rules for CTE naming were patched, but the verifier still pins the old fingerprint. Fix: update the pinned fingerprint in the verifier config, then re-run the promote job. Do not bypass verification. For reference, the current signing key is below.

signing key of bagap-yawep = bky13_TbfT6ZMUoGJo2

Internal Memo — Divestiture of the Coldpath Services Unit. Branch managers: Hallowen Industries has agreed in principle to sell the Coldpath unit to Renfrew Holdings. Day-to-day operations continue unchanged until close. Direct all staff questions to your regional lead and avoid external comment. Further context for managers appears in the note below.

management briefing: Project Ulavan slips by two quarters because of the staffing delay.